Gibson SJ Southern Jumbo Model Flat Top Acoustic Guitar, c. 1946, made in Kalamazoo, Michigan, sunburst top, dark back and sides finish, mahogany back, sides and neck; spruce top, rosewood fingerboard, soft shell case.
 
Overall length is 40 3/4 in. (103.5 cm.), 16 1/8 in. (41 cm.) wide at lower bout, and 4 7/8 in. (12.4 cm.) in depth at side, taken at the end block. Scale length is 24 3/4 in. (629 mm.). Width of nut is 1 13/16 in. (46 mm.). Well played but very nice original guitar; a lot of strumwear to the top and finish well-worn on the back of the neck but no damage or repairs. Original bridge and bridgeplate (even bridgepins!), WW II style Kluson tuners. A recent neck set makes this a very fine player, with a big smooth sound. Very Good + Condition.
